Matrix Receivables Ltd v Musst Holdings Ltd (Re Costs) [2024] EWHC 2245 (Ch) (30 August 2024)

A payment on account of costs should be calculated as 60% of the costs schedule of 2 May 2024 and 50% of the additional costs, reflecting caution regarding the substantial increase in costs and the need for scrutiny on detailed assessment.

Orders

  • Musst Holdings Limited to pay Matrix Receivables Limited £151,828.20 as payment on account of costs for the March Application within 28 days from the date of the order.
